Speed is measured in rotations per minute (RPM) and will either be a fixed speed or a variable speed. The much better choice is variable speed as it gives you much better control. It also allows you to use the right speed depending on what material you are cutting, such as soft woods, hard woods and metal. You also want a longer stroke length and anything over 200 mm is a great choice.

The Makita DJV184 is a top handle type cordless jigsaw powered by an 18v LXT Li-Ion battery (sold separately). The d ie-cast aluminum base plate can be swivelled by 45° on both sides. Lightweight jigsaw with low noise and low vibration. With bright double LED. This 18V power tool has a high torque output thanks to its brushless motor design. It also has a variable 6 – speed control dial that allows users to set the speed between 800 – 3,500 SPM as well as 3 different orbital settings. The motor has a 6-speed setting that allows users to choose between 800 – 3500 SPM. It also has 3 orbital settings to increase its versatility in various applications.A unique feature of this jigsaw by Makita, the soft no load system allows users to conserve battery when the machine is not in operation. When the sensor detects little to no resistance on the blade, the motor speed is automatically turned down.
